Homicide Suspect Arrested At Wawa

A man wanted for homicide was arrested Friday morning in Falls Township.

Trevon Manning, 25, of Trenton, was apprehended around 5:52 a.m. after Falls Township police responded to the Wawa in the Morrisville section of the township to assist an outside agency, authorities said.

Bucks County 9-1-1 advised Falls Township officers that New Jersey detectives were tracking a Chevrolet Equinox believed to be carrying a subject wanted for homicide, police said.

At the Wawa, Falls Township officers made contact with Manning, the passenger in the vehicle, and confirmed he had an active arrest warrant out of New Jersey for homicide, police said.

Few additional details on the homicide in New Jersey were available.

District Judge Mick Petrucci preliminarily arraigned Manning on a fugitive from justice charge Friday. The 25-year-old man is currently being held at the Bucks County Correctional Facility awaiting a hearing for extradition to New Jersey.

On Thursday, Falls Township police, the Bucks County Sheriff’s Office, and the U.S. Marshals Service arrested a man wanted for an attempted murder. The man was wanted in New Jersey, and the incidents were not connected.
